Choosing the Right Open Source Solutions
The first step in building a multi-million dollar business with OSS is choosing the right solutions. This involves identifying the specific business needs and matching them with the available OSS options. The following factors should be considered:
- License Compatibility: Ensure that the license of the OSS aligns with the intended use and distribution plans.
- Community Support: Look for OSS projects with active communities that provide documentation, support, and updates.
- Security and Reliability: Choose OSS solutions that have been well-tested and have a proven track record of security and reliability.
- Cost-Effectiveness: Consider the long-term costs associated with using OSS, including development, deployment, and maintenance.
Case Study: WordPress
WordPress is a widely-used content management system (CMS) that has been instrumental in the success of countless businesses. The platform's open source nature has allowed developers to build a vast ecosystem of plugins and themes, creating a virtually limitless range of functionality.
Automattic, the company behind WordPress, has grown the platform into a multi-billion dollar business through a combination of:
- Freemium Model: Providing a free core platform while offering premium services for additional features.
- Community Engagement: Building a strong community of developers and users who contribute to the platform's growth.
- Strategic Partnerships: Collaborating with other open source projects and companies to extend the WordPress ecosystem.

Case Study: Red Hat
Red Hat is a leading provider of enterprise open source software. The company has built a multi-billion dollar business by:
- Offering Enterprise Support: Providing professional support and services for its open source products.
- Acquiring and Integrating: Acquiring other OSS companies to expand its portfolio and customer base.
- Community Involvement: Actively participating in open source communities and contributing to the development of OSS projects.

Revenue Models
OSS businesses can adopt various revenue models to generate income:
- Freemium Model: Offering a basic product or service for free while charging for premium features.
- Subscription Model: Providing access to software or services on a subscription basis.
- Enterprise Support: Providing professional support and services for businesses using OSS.
- Customization and Consulting: Offering customized solutions and consulting services to meet specific customer requirements.
- Licensing Fees: Charging fees for commercial use or distribution of OSS under certain licenses.
